GOOGLE PIXEL 8A SPECS LEAKED AHEAD OF INDIA LAUNCH, ALL WE KNOW SO FAR

Google Pixel 8a is expected to launch this month and even though the tech giant is yet to give a release date for the smartphone, anticipation for the same is riding high. Earlier rumours had said that the smartphone could be unveiled as soon as this month, potentially during the Google I/O 2024 event slated to begin on May 14. Rumours also suggest that the launch could see the phone becoming available for pre-order in India and across the globe shortly thereafter.

Several specifications of the Pixel 8a have leaked online previously. In terms of design, leaked images have earlier hinted that the Pixel 8a will come with a familiar design, featuring a punch-hole display framed by rounded edges. Then, the right edge might house the volume and power buttons and the left side might be equipped with a SIM port. At the bottom, we might get to see a charging port. The back of the phone is expected to sport a distinctive camera module with a thick horizontal strap housing two sensors and an LED flash, aligning with Google's characteristic design language.

In the front, the phone is rumoured to be equipped with a 6.1-inch FHD+ OLED display with 120 Hz refresh rate. In terms of processor, the phone is expected to run on the Tensor G3 chipset, similar to the one used in the Google Pixel 8 series. The camera setup is expected to include a 64-megapixel main camera with Optical Image Stabilization (OIS) and a 13-megapixel ultra-wide sensor at the rear, complemented by a 13-megapixel camera at the front for selfies. 

On the software front, the device is expected to operate on Android 14 right out of the box, with Google promising up to seven years of Android and security updates. The Pixel 8a is also speculated to feature a 4,500mAh battery supported by 27W fast charging. Additional features could include wireless charging and an IP67 rating for dust and water resistance. The phone is also expected to have a suite of AI features like Circle to Search, Live Translate, Magic Eraser, and Audio Magic Eraser, underscoring Google's focus on integrating advanced technology to enhance user experience.

In terms of price, the Pixel 8a is projected to be slightly more expensive than its predecessor, the Pixel 7a. In India, the new model could start at approximately Rs 45,000, marking an increase of Rs 1,000 to Rs 2,000. Internationally, the price points are expected to be around $499 for the 128GB version and $559 for the 256GB version, which translates to about Rs 41,600 and Rs 46,600 respectively. The phone might also come in four colour options, including Obsidian, Porcelain, Bay, and Mint. A previous leak from Evan Blass had said that the tech giant might also launch colour-coordinated cases for the phone, so that users can choose accordingly.
